Activities - how the charity spends its money
The main activities of the World Bhangra Council are to advance the education of the public in Bhangra by promoting, sustaining and increasing knowledge and understanding of Bhangra through continued research and practice. Our success is based on active dialogue between artists and academics.

Charitable objects
THE OBJECTS OF THE CIO ARE: (1) TO ADVANCE THE EDUCATION OF THE PUBLIC IN BHANGRA BY PROMOTING, SUSTAINING AND INCREASING KNOWLEDGE AND UNDERSTANDING OF BHANGRA THROUGH CONTINUED RESEARCH AND PRACTICE. (2) TO ADVANCE THE ART FORM OF BHANGRA AND ITS ASSOCIATED HERITAGE AND CULTURE THROUGH PERFORMANCE AND IN SUCH OTHER WAYS AS THE TRUSTEES CONSIDER APPROPRIATE.
